ePortfolio version 3 Release notes:

The RCGP is pleased to announce that Version 3.0 of the ePortfolio is now live.

This new version includes electronic Annual Review of Competence Progression (ARCP) functionality, improvements to the reviews and bug fixes.  As part of the ARCP functionality Trainees can now make apply for their CCT recommendation directly from the ePortfolio.

The following is a list of new functions and bug fixes:

New Roles:

  • Panel Member: New user for panels; able to see ESR put forward for Trainee and to enter recommendations for signoff.
  • Panel Chair: Able to signoff ARCP as complete.

 

New Functions:

  • Educational Supervisor Review (ESR): Can now be seen by Trainees and Deaneries as well.
  • ESR: New layout to give all information in one place.
  • ESR: Additional fields for more specific feedback.
  • ESR: Can now be marked as complete by Educational Supervisor. Once complete, the review is sent to the trainee for acceptance.
  • ESR: Trainees now sign off completed reviews and receive notification that they have pending reviews to signoff. Once they have signed off a review as accepted, it can no longer be edited.
  • ARCP: This will now be electronic and completed within the ePortfolio.
  • Apply for CCT: This will now send an electronic submission to Certification once all parts have been completed.
  • Review Periods: There are now a number of review choices for Less than Full Time Trainees. These are set for 50% trainees, but can be used for other ratios as well.

 

Changed Functions:

  • CPR/AED certificate signoff: This can now be signed off under the ESR if it is not showing under Progress to Certification for any reason.
  • OOH: OOH sessions still need to be added to the learning log. However due to different requirements in different deaneries and final panels before end of training, the required count of 12 will no longer trigger this as being complete. Instead the Educational Supervisor can sign this off under the ESR. This will allow for requirements to be met before final panels and allow for all circumstances.
  • Post Creation: Several fields when creating a post are compulsory. This is to ensure complete post information is included on Trainee ARCP forms.
  • Increased Storage Space for all trainees.

 

Bug Fixes:

  • Option for non-trainees to produce ticket code removed. This will prevent an error occurring.
  • Option for Trainers to release PSQ results removed. Only Educational Supervisors should be able to do this; when Trainers tried to do so it was causing an error.
  • Apostrophes: Some users had problems with the forms page or logging in if they have an apostrophe in their email address. This has been corrected.
  • End Dates: End dates for various things (ticket codes, posts, reviews) were not working correctly and terminating at the start of the day instead of the end of the day. This has been corrected.
  • Trainer/Supervisor Trainee Summary: Correct evidence will now appear on the summary screen.
  • Upload attachments: It is no longer possible to try to upload an attachment before selecting a file.
  • Upload icons: These will no longer show if an entry does not have an attachment
  • Evidence view: Any period having “miniCEX or equivalent” has been changed to “miniCex or COT” and will now display COTs under the summary.
  • Evidence view: Corrected assessments required per period.
  • Declarations: Trainees will now get a warning if they try to sign declarations without being in a post.
  • Learning Log: Educational Supervisors can now select Alternate Curricula under Validate against Competency.
  • Learning Log: Trainees can no longer edit Learning Log entries that have been marked as read.
  • Deanery Admin View: AKT/CSA/CCT. This now will show your trainees AKT/CSA/CCT progress

 

Bug fixes since version 2:

There have been several bug fixes since version 2 that were released prior to Version 3.  We thought we would list some of them here:

 

  • Evidence Section: Fixed a bug where false PSQ results were appearing on the summary mimicking the number of MSF submitted.
  • Learning Log: Fixed a bug that was causing Curriculum Headings for new entries to appear on an old entry.
  • MSF: Corrected a problem that was causing MSF results to not stay released.
  • Speed: The overall speed of the ePortfolio has been greatly increased. We are still looking at ways to further improve this.
